public static class Post.APIRequestGet extends APIRequest<Post>
APIRequest.DefaultAsyncRequestExecutor, APIRequest.DefaultRequestExecutor, APIRequest.IAsyncRequestExecutor, APIRequest.IRequestExecutor, APIRequest.RequestHelper, APIRequest.ResponseParser<T extends APINode>, APIRequest.ResponseWrapper| Modifier and Type | Field and Description |
|---|---|
static String[] |
FIELDS |
static String[] |
PARAMS |
context, endpoint, method, nodeId, paramNames, params, parser, returnFields, USER_AGENT, useVideoEndpoint| Constructor and Description |
|---|
APIRequestGet(String nodeId,
APIContext context) |
addToBatch, addToBatch, addToBatch, changeAsyncRequestExecutor, changeRequestExecutor, executeAsyncBase, executeAsyncBase, executeAsyncInternal, executeAsyncInternal, executeInternal, executeInternal, getAsyncExecutor, getContext, getExecutor, joinStringList, requestFieldInternal, setContext, setOverrideUrl, setParamInternal, setParamsInternal, setUseVideoEndpointpublic APIRequestGet(String nodeId, APIContext context)
public Post getLastResponse()
getLastResponse in class APIRequest<Post>public Post parseResponse(String response, String header) throws APIException
parseResponse in class APIRequest<Post>APIExceptionpublic Post execute() throws APIException
execute in class APIRequest<Post>APIExceptionpublic Post execute(Map<String,Object> extraParams) throws APIException
execute in class APIRequest<Post>AP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<Post> executeAsync() throws APIException
AP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<Post> executeAsync(Map<String,Object> extraParams) throws APIException
APIExceptionpublic Post.APIRequestGet setParam(String param, Object value)
setParam in class APIRequest<Post>public Post.APIRequestGet setParams(Map<String,Object> params)
setParams in class APIRequest<Post>public Post.APIRequestGet requestAllFields()
public Post.APIRequestGet requestAllFields(boolean value)
public Post.APIRequestGet requestFields(List<String> fields)
requestFields in class APIRequest<Post>public Post.APIRequestGet requestFields(List<String> fields, boolean value)
requestFields in class APIRequest<Post>public Post.APIRequestGet requestField(String field)
requestField in class APIRequest<Post>public Post.APIRequestGet requestField(String field, boolean value)
requestField in class APIRequest<Post>public Post.APIRequestGet requestActionsField()
public Post.APIRequestGet requestActionsField(boolean value)
public Post.APIRequestGet requestAdminCreatorField()
public Post.APIRequestGet requestAdminCreatorField(boolean value)
public Post.APIRequestGet requestAllowedAdvertisingObjectivesField()
public Post.APIRequestGet requestAllowedAdvertisingObjectivesField(boolean value)
public Post.APIRequestGet requestApplicationField()
public Post.APIRequestGet requestApplicationField(boolean value)
public Post.APIRequestGet requestBackdatedTimeField()
public Post.APIRequestGet requestBackdatedTimeField(boolean value)
public Post.APIRequestGet requestCallToActionField()
public Post.APIRequestGet requestCallToActionField(boolean value)
public Post.APIRequestGet requestCanReplyPrivatelyField()
public Post.APIRequestGet requestCanReplyPrivatelyField(boolean value)
public Post.APIRequestGet requestCaptionField()
public Post.APIRequestGet requestCaptionField(boolean value)
public Post.APIRequestGet requestChildAttachmentsField()
public Post.APIRequestGet requestChildAttachmentsField(boolean value)
public Post.APIRequestGet requestCommentsMirroringDomainField()
public Post.APIRequestGet requestCommentsMirroringDomainField(boolean value)
public Post.APIRequestGet requestCoordinatesField()
public Post.APIRequestGet requestCoordinatesField(boolean value)
public Post.APIRequestGet requestCreatedTimeField()
public Post.APIRequestGet requestCreatedTimeField(boolean value)
public Post.APIRequestGet requestDeliveryGrowthOptimizationsField()
public Post.APIRequestGet requestDeliveryGrowthOptimizationsField(boolean value)
public Post.APIRequestGet requestDescriptionField()
public Post.APIRequestGet requestDescriptionField(boolean value)
public Post.APIRequestGet requestEntitiesField()
public Post.APIRequestGet requestEntitiesField(boolean value)
public Post.APIRequestGet requestEventField()
public Post.APIRequestGet requestEventField(boolean value)
public Post.APIRequestGet requestExpandedHeightField()
public Post.APIRequestGet requestExpandedHeightField(boolean value)
public Post.APIRequestGet requestExpandedWidthField()
public Post.APIRequestGet requestExpandedWidthField(boolean value)
public Post.APIRequestGet requestFeedTargetingField()
public Post.APIRequestGet requestFeedTargetingField(boolean value)
public Post.APIRequestGet requestFormattingField()
public Post.APIRequestGet requestFormattingField(boolean value)
public Post.APIRequestGet requestFromField()
public Post.APIRequestGet requestFromField(boolean value)
public Post.APIRequestGet requestFullPictureField()
public Post.APIRequestGet requestFullPictureField(boolean value)
public Post.APIRequestGet requestHeightField()
public Post.APIRequestGet requestHeightField(boolean value)
public Post.APIRequestGet requestIconField()
public Post.APIRequestGet requestIconField(boolean value)
public Post.APIRequestGet requestIdField()
public Post.APIRequestGet requestIdField(boolean value)
public Post.APIRequestGet requestImplicitPlaceField()
public Post.APIRequestGet requestImplicitPlaceField(boolean value)
public Post.APIRequestGet requestInstagramEligibilityField()
public Post.APIRequestGet requestInstagramEligibilityField(boolean value)
public Post.APIRequestGet requestInstreamEligibilityField()
public Post.APIRequestGet requestInstreamEligibilityField(boolean value)
public Post.APIRequestGet requestIsAppShareField()
public Post.APIRequestGet requestIsAppShareField(boolean value)
public Post.APIRequestGet requestIsEligibleForPromotionField()
public Post.APIRequestGet requestIsEligibleForPromotionField(boolean value)
public Post.APIRequestGet requestIsExpiredField()
public Post.APIRequestGet requestIsExpiredField(boolean value)
public Post.APIRequestGet requestIsHiddenField()
public Post.APIRequestGet requestIsHiddenField(boolean value)
public Post.APIRequestGet requestIsInlineCreatedField()
public Post.APIRequestGet requestIsInlineCreatedField(boolean value)
public Post.APIRequestGet requestIsInstagramEligibleField()
public Post.APIRequestGet requestIsInstagramEligibleField(boolean value)
public Post.APIRequestGet requestIsPopularField()
public Post.APIRequestGet requestIsPopularField(boolean value)
public Post.APIRequestGet requestIsPublishedField()
public Post.APIRequestGet requestIsPublishedField(boolean value)
public Post.APIRequestGet requestIsSphericalField()
public Post.APIRequestGet requestIsSphericalField(boolean value)
public Post.APIRequestGet requestLinkField()
public Post.APIRequestGet requestLinkField(boolean value)
public Post.APIRequestGet requestLiveVideoEligibilityField()
public Post.APIRequestGet requestLiveVideoEligibilityField(boolean value)
public Post.APIRequestGet requestMessageField()
public Post.APIRequestGet requestMessageField(boolean value)
public Post.APIRequestGet requestMessageTagsField()
public Post.APIRequestGet requestMessageTagsField(boolean value)
public Post.APIRequestGet requestMultiShareEndCardField()
public Post.APIRequestGet requestMultiShareEndCardField(boolean value)
public Post.APIRequestGet requestMultiShareOptimizedField()
public Post.APIRequestGet requestMultiShareOptimizedField(boolean value)
public Post.APIRequestGet requestNameField()
public Post.APIRequestGet requestNameField(boolean value)
public Post.APIRequestGet requestObjectIdField()
public Post.APIRequestGet requestObjectIdField(boolean value)
public Post.APIRequestGet requestParentIdField()
public Post.APIRequestGet requestParentIdField(boolean value)
public Post.APIRequestGet requestPermalinkUrlField()
public Post.APIRequestGet requestPermalinkUrlField(boolean value)
public Post.APIRequestGet requestPictureField()
public Post.APIRequestGet requestPictureField(boolean value)
public Post.APIRequestGet requestPlaceField()
public Post.APIRequestGet requestPlaceField(boolean value)
public Post.APIRequestGet requestPollField()
public Post.APIRequestGet requestPollField(boolean value)
public Post.APIRequestGet requestPrivacyField()
public Post.APIRequestGet requestPrivacyField(boolean value)
public Post.APIRequestGet requestPromotableIdField()
public Post.APIRequestGet requestPromotableIdField(boolean value)
public Post.APIRequestGet requestPromotionStatusField()
public Post.APIRequestGet requestPromotionStatusField(boolean value)
public Post.APIRequestGet requestPropertiesField()
public Post.APIRequestGet requestPropertiesField(boolean value)
public Post.APIRequestGet requestPublishingStatsField()
public Post.APIRequestGet requestPublishingStatsField(boolean value)
public Post.APIRequestGet requestScheduledPublishTimeField()
public Post.APIRequestGet requestScheduledPublishTimeField(boolean value)
public Post.APIRequestGet requestSharesField()
public Post.APIRequestGet requestSharesField(boolean value)
public Post.APIRequestGet requestSourceField()
public Post.APIRequestGet requestSourceField(boolean value)
public Post.APIRequestGet requestStatusTypeField()
public Post.APIRequestGet requestStatusTypeField(boolean value)
public Post.APIRequestGet requestStoryField()
public Post.APIRequestGet requestStoryField(boolean value)
public Post.APIRequestGet requestStoryTagsField()
public Post.APIRequestGet requestStoryTagsField(boolean value)
public Post.APIRequestGet requestSubscribedField()
public Post.APIRequestGet requestSubscribedField(boolean value)
public Post.APIRequestGet requestTargetField()
public Post.APIRequestGet requestTargetField(boolean value)
public Post.APIRequestGet requestTargetingField()
public Post.APIRequestGet requestTargetingField(boolean value)
public Post.APIRequestGet requestTimelineVisibilityField()
public Post.APIRequestGet requestTimelineVisibilityField(boolean value)
public Post.APIRequestGet requestTranslationsField()
public Post.APIRequestGet requestTranslationsField(boolean value)
public Post.APIRequestGet requestTypeField()
public Post.APIRequestGet requestTypeField(boolean value)
public Post.APIRequestGet requestUpdatedTimeField()
public Post.APIRequestGet requestUpdatedTimeField(boolean value)
public Post.APIRequestGet requestViaField()
public Post.APIRequestGet requestViaField(boolean value)
public Post.APIRequestGet requestVideoBuyingEligibilityField()
public Post.APIRequestGet requestVideoBuyingEligibilityField(boolean value)
public Post.APIRequestGet requestWidthField()
public Post.APIRequestGet requestWidthField(boolean value)
public Post.APIRequestGet requestWillBeAutocroppedWhenDeliverToInstagramField()
public Post.APIRequestGet requestWillBeAutocroppedWhenDeliverToInstagramField(boolean value)
Copyright © 2020. All rights reserved.